日期:2014-05-20  浏览次数:21022 次

linq语法实现row_number的sql语句
大家有没有好的linq语法实现下列sql语句?
select
  id=row_number() over (order by ID),* from table1

table1我进行了添加、编辑、删除操作。我想在操作后ID列能重新从小到大增长排列!
感谢各位!

------解决方案--------------------
实现不能。。。
------解决方案--------------------
var tt = db.table1.Sort(p=>p.ID)
或者
var tt = db.table1.orderBy(p=>p.ID)

------解决方案--------------------
不是很明白lz的意思。